Optimizing Machine Settings and Parameters
Optimizing machine settings and parameters is essential for enhancing operational efficiency in CNC machining. By fine-tuning these settings, manufacturers can achieve better precision and reduce production costs. Precision is critical in high-stakes environments. Key parameters to consider include spindle speed, feed rate, and tool selection. Each of these factors directly impacts the quality of the final product.
For instance, adjusting the spindle speed can significantly influence the material removal rate. A higher spindle speed may lead to faster machining but can also increase wear on tools. Tool wear affects long-term costs. Therefore, it is crucial to find a balance that maximizes productivity while minimizing tool replacement expenses. Balancing costs is a smart strategy.
Additionally, the feed rate should be optimized based on the material being machined. Different materials require specific feed rates to ensure optimal cutting performance. This tailored approach can enhance efficiency and reduce cycle times. Reducing cycle times is financially beneficial. Furthermore, selecting the right tools for specific applications can lead to improved surface finishes and reduced machining time. Quality tools yield better results.
